BACKGROUND: As provided in the January 24, 2012 status report on `Proposed Purpose, Composition and Function of Orange County's Reformulated Economic Development Advisory Board; Orange County Economic Development staff have been working to revise the structure and function of an Economic Development Advisory Board to most effectively support the Commissioners' vision for economic development in Orange County going forward. The attached `Economic Development Advisory Board Policies and Procedures' document, and the list of potential candidates for the Economic Development Advisory Board, were developed to reflect the Board of Commissioners' recent efforts to reformulate an Advisory Board aligned with the County's revamped Economic Development focus. Input from a diverse group of individuals and groups invested in the future of economic development in Orange County have been incorporated into both the proposed structure and composition of the reformulated advisory board. The attached documents include feedback from a variety of groups and individuals, including the Chambers of Commerce and representatives from UNC. Several potential advisory body structures were evaluated, and the attached `Economic Development Advisory Board Policies and Procedure' and list of potential appointees reflect staff's thinking for the most effective model for Orange County's Economic Development program going forward. 2 The attached `Economic Development Advisory Board Policies and Procedures' document differs from the version reviewed at the Board's April 19, 2012 meeting as follows: 1) Section III. B. 1. Composition - the number of voting members was increased to 10 (to reflect the addition of a nonprofit member). 2) Section III. B. 1. F. - a representative from the nonprofit sector was added. 3) New Section III. B. 2. - while all members must have a concerted business interest in Orange County, only a majority of the members must be residents of Orange County. 4) Old Section III. B. 2. Referencing chair and vice chair selection was removed as this scope is covered in the `Orange County Board of County Commissioners Advisory Board Policy' Section IV. C. 5) Old Section III. B. 5. Referencing length of service was removed as this scope is covered in the `Orange County Board of County Commissioners Advisory Board Policy' Section III. E. 6) Old Section IV. B. referencing agendas was removed as this scope is covered in the `Orange County Board of County Commissioners Advisory Board Policy' Section VI. E. As provided in Section III.B.1. of the Economic Development Advisory Board Policies and Procedure, the composition of the Advisory Board has been distributed among six (6) basic sectors to represent the diversity of businesses in Orange County. While numerous potential appointees were contacted, not all were able to commit to serve in this capacity. Only those that have agreed to serve as active members of the Advisory Board, should they be selected, are included in the attached list of potential appointees. The proposed appointees have been reviewed and submitted for consideration due to each individual's ability to maximize the diversity of skills, and therefore enhance the County's revamped Economic Development program from a variety of vantage points. Each appointee either manages a business in Orange County, or has significant interest in, or ties to Orange County's economic development. As outlined in the document `Orange County Board of Commissioners Advisory Board Policy', section III, E. 2), the term for all appointees will be staggered, as follows: • 4 members - 3 year term • 4 members - 2 year term • 2 members - 1 year term In addition to the Advisory Board, a group of `Technical Advisors' will be identified to assist the Economic Development program on an as-needed basis, providing input on specific issues. The Technical Advisor group will be identified as the specific need arises, with the input of both Economic Development staff and the Economic Development Advisory Board. Choose ONE individual representing the nonprofit sector. Attachment 1 4 ECONOMIC DEVELOPMENTADVISORY BOARD POLICIES AND PROCEDURES SECTION I: SCOPE A. Purpose 1. To establish a policy and procedures whereby the Orange County Board of Commissioners will establish the specific policies and procedures governing the Economic Development Advisory Board. 2. The Orange County Board of Commissioners may establish and appoint an advisory board whose duty is to serve in an advisory capacity to Orange County's Economic Development department in support of its core mission of encouraging economic development within Orange County. B. Authority 1. North Carolina General Statute 153A-76 grants boards of county commissioners the authority to establish advisory boards. 2. North Carolina General Statute 158-8 grants boards of county commissioners the authority to establish economic development advisory boards. 3. The Orange County Advisory Board Policy serves as the underlying policy document to which the Economic Development Advisory Board, in addition to this policy and procedure document, is subject. 4. In the event that there is a conflict between the Orange County Advisory Board Policy and this Policies and Procedures document, this Policies and Procedures document shall control. C. Charge 1. The charge of the Economic Development Advisory Board is as follows: a) Work cohesively with Orange County's Economic Development staff and their economic development partners to position Orange County as a competitive location for business opportunities. b) Although the Economic Development Advisory Board membership will represent a variety of business and geographic interests, the Economic Development Advisory Board, as a whole will work together for the good of Orange County as a whole. c) The Economic Development Advisory Board will function under the guidelines for growth set out in Orange County's Land Use Plan. d) The Economic Development Advisory Board shall provide an Annual Report to the Board of County Commissioners, summarizing its activities, successes and programs of the past year. SECTION II: GOALS AND OBJECTIVES A. Goals 1. Support and encourage commercial and industrial growth in Orange County. 2. Create desirable jobs for Orange County's citizens. Page 1 of 4 April 23, 2012 Attachment 1 5 ECONOMIC DEVELOPMENTADVISORY BOARD POLICIES AND PROCEDURES B. Objectives 1. Meet with prospective clients, and be involved with select economic development endeavors; 2. Participate and advise in discussions, evaluations, and decisions on appropriate economic development uses of the proceeds from the quarter cent sales tax; 3. Craft, analyze and promote economic development initiatives; 4. Identify and review potential new markets; 5. Assist in planning economic development policy; 6. Actively engage in stimulating community discussions on economic development issues; 7. Assist with the small business loan program; 8. Set priorities on the location and type of infrastructure (water, sewer, fiber) for the County's Economic Development Districts; 9. Help determine how Orange County might partner with the towns on economic development initiatives; and 10. Assist and advise on the recommended areas suitable for economic development and commercial nodes. SECTION III: MEMBERSHIP A. Authority 1. North Carolina General Statute 153A-76 grants boards of county commissioners the authority to establish advisory boards and to appoint members to and remove members from those advisory boards. In acting on this authority the Orange County Board of Commissioners hereby establishes certain general conditions to which applicants and members of advisory boards should conform. B. Composition 1. The Economic Development Advisory Board is composed of 10 voting members. Members shall include representatives from the following sectors: a. Orange County's_core business communitv, including banking, construction, manufacturing, architecture, real estate, legal, development, utility management, etc. b. An individual who represents a~riculture: c. An individual actively involved in entrenreneur activities; d. An individual representing the Universitv of North Carolina at Chaael Hill. preferably involved in the development activities, such as planning for Carolina North, or on the foundation side of business development; e. The tourism sector represented by an individual involved in retail and/or hospitality, such as a restaurant or hotel manager, or someone involved in the arts; f. An individual representing the nonprofit sector; and Page 2 of 4 April 23, 2012 Attachment 1 6 ECONOMIC DEVELOPMENT ADVISORY BOARD POLICIES AND PROCEDURES g. At some point in the future, a representative of Duke Universitv preferably involved in development activities that may have an impact on Orange County including support of university spin-off entities, may be included. 2. A majority of inembers shall be residents of Orange County and shall maintain their domicile in Orange County. Domicile is defined as one's permanent established home as distinguished from one's temporary although actual place of residence. The Clerk shall confirm the residency of applicants. 3. Members shall have a direct or indirect background in economic development, and be actively involved in promoting business. Candidates should either live in Orange County, have invested in Orange County, or have a direct economic development interest in Orange County. 4. The Hillsborough/Orange County Chamber of Commerce and the Chapel Hill/Carrboro Chamber of Commerce shall assist the Orange County Economic Develop staff to review, recruit and recommend potential candidates. 5. There shall be an Economic Development Working Group that will be comprised of economic development professionals, such as economic development practitioners from the municipalities of Orange County, the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ill, and Durham Technical Community College. a. This group will assist the Orange County Economic Development department with special projects, on an 'as needed' basis. b. Members of this group will be selected based on their skill set and the special project to be addressed. c. Selection of these group members will be by the Orange County Economic Development department and/or appropriate members of the Economic Development Advisory Board. d. The working group will adhere to the same policies and procedures as the Economic Development Advisory Board, with the exception of their provisional nature. SECTION IV. MEETINGS A. Staffing 1. Orange County staff may serve a support function to advisory boards upon the approval of the Orange County Manager. B. Joint Meetings 1. The Economic Development Advisory Board may attend an annual meeting with the Orange County Board of Commissioners to review and discuss its activities and accomplishments. Page 3 of 4 April 23, 2012 Attachment 1 ~ ECONOMIC DEVELOPMENT ADVISORY BOARD POLICIES AND PROCEDURES SECTION V. ORIENTATION A. Attendance 1. Each member shall attend an orientation presented by the Economic Development department to familiarize the advisory board members with the operation of County government, the Economic Development department rules, and the operating procedures of the advisory board. 2. Each voting member will be encouraged to complete the orientation within four weeks of his or her appointment. Additional training will be developed as needed. SECTION VI. BY-LAWS A. By-Laws 1. Any bylaws adopted by the Economic Development Commission or Economic Development Advisory Board are void and no further bylaws shall be adopted. Procedure shall be governed solely by this policy document and the General Advisory Board Policy Document. 2. The Economic Development Advisory Board shall, for the purposes of conducting discussion and debate only, follow the Rules of Procedure for the Board of County Commissioners. 3. Should the Economic Development Advisory Board determine modifications to policies and procedures are necessary, the Economic Development Advisory Board may petition the Board of County Commissioners for such modi~cations.
